Lovely modernised, tastefuly decorated hotel.
Spotlessly clean lobby, lits and rooms.
Super friendly genuine staff in all areas who take time to chat.
Basic cafe, but great coffee served by friendly staff.
Excellent bed and pillows in rooms. Nice furnishings, plus mine had a fridge, safe and sofa courtesy of an upgrade offer.
The bathroom was spotless. Always lots of hot water, and clean, soft, towels. Decent quality soaps etc too.
Housekeeping were great, quiet and respectful of guests privacy, but always friendly and helpful if needed.
The tables and chairs on the sidewalk outside which guests and some passers by use to sit and have coffee/lunch or a smoke are a nice touch..the tables could use a good wipedown sometimes though, and an ashtray to save having to throw cigarette butts on the ground/curb area would be good
Although the hotel was busy, it was never noisy or crammed feeling. Similarly hallways and rooms were never noisy.
My only real issue was with in room air-con. It was awful. I mentioned at reception a couple of times and got differing replies. In the end I turned mine off totaly and slept with the window open...not ideal for noise sensitive folks, but Im well used to NYC noise.
Diners, restaurants, bars,, shops, transport are all right outside and around about. (Cosmic Diner do beautiful fresh breakfasts)
Hell's Kitchen is my new favourite area in NYC, and Romer's my hotel of choice.
